Dr. Cassius Ochoa Chaar has over 10 years of experience in the field of Vascular Surgery. He earned his B.S. in Biology from the American University of Beirut and his MD-MS from the same institution. After completing his residency at Yale New Haven Hospital, he pursued a fellowship in Vascular Surgery at the University of Pittsburgh Medical Center. Currently, Dr. Ochoa Chaar is an Associate Professor of Surgery in the Division of Vascular Surgery at Yale University School of Medicine. He is board certified in General Surgery and Vascular Surgery.
